.cust-customer-stories-main{background:url(https://info.thoughtindustries.com/hubfs/Review_Bg.png);background-repeat:no-repeat;background-size:cover;overflow:hidden;padding:79px 20px 75px;position:relative}.cust-customer-stories-main .main-container{margin:auto;max-width:794px}.cust-customer-stories-main>.main-container>div:first-child{color:#f9ed2e;font-family:Poppins;font-size:14px;font-style:normal;font-weight:600;letter-spacing:.02em;line-height:115%;margin-bottom:18px;text-align:center;text-transform:uppercase}.cust-customer-story-group-main .review_info-row{align-items:center;display:flex;gap:20px}.cust-customer-stories-main .main_title{margin-bottom:70px;text-align:center}.cust-customer-stories-main .main_title [data-hs-cos-field=main_title]{color:#fff;font-family:Poppins;font-size:32px;font-style:normal;font-weight:700;line-height:115%}.main_title div,.main_title h2{color:#181b4d;font-size:62px;font-weight:700;letter-spacing:-2px;line-height:1.1;margin:0}.custom-customer-row{margin:auto;max-width:800px}.cust-customer-story-group-main{display:grid;gap:20px;grid-template-columns:repeat(2,1fr)}.cust-customer-story-group-single{background:#fff;border-radius:15px;box-shadow:4px 4px 20px rgba(0,0,0,.25);overflow:hidden;padding:35px;position:relative;transition:.45s ease;z-index:1}.cust-customer-story-group-single:hover{box-shadow:0 25px 55px rgba(0,0,0,.14);transform:translateY(-10px)}.cust-customer-story-group-single:after{background:rgba(255,44,146,.05);border-radius:50%;height:220px;right:-100px;top:-120px;width:220px;z-index:-1}.cust-customer-stories-main .book-demo-sec{margin-top:59px}.review_description{margin-bottom:36px;position:relative}.review_description:before{color:rgba(24,27,77,.05);font-size:120px;font-weight:700;left:-10px;line-height:1;top:-40px}a.book-demo:hover{background:#00abbd!important}.review_description div,.review_description p,.review_description span{color:#373c44;font-family:Inter;font-size:17px;font-style:italic;font-weight:400;line-height:145%}.review_image{margin-bottom:0}.review_image img{display:block;height:78px;margin:0;object-fit:contain;width:78px}.cust-customer-story-group-single>div:last-child{border-top:1px solid #00000010;padding-top:18px}.cust-customer-story-group-single{margin:auto;width:100%}.cust-customer-story-group-single,.cust-customer-story-group-single>div:last-child div,.cust-customer-story-group-single>div:last-child p,.cust-customer-story-group-single>div:last-child span{color:#373c44;font-family:Inter;font-size:15px;font-style:normal;font-weight:700;line-height:135%;text-align:left}.cust-customer-story-group-single strong{color:#181b4d;font-weight:700}.cust-customer-story-group-single strong:last-child{color:#ff2c92}@media (max-width:991px){.cust-customer-stories-main{padding:50px 20px}.cust-customer-stories-main .main_title{margin-bottom:40px}.main_title div,.main_title h2{font-size:46px}.cust-customer-story-group-main{gap:24px}.cust-customer-story-group-single{padding:34px 28px}.review_description div,.review_description p,.review_description span{font-size:19px}}@media (max-width:767px){.main_title{margin-bottom:30px}.main_title div,.main_title h2{font-size:32px;line-height:1.2}.cust-customer-story-group-main{gap:20px;grid-template-columns:1fr}.cust-customer-story-group-single{padding:15px}.review_description{margin-bottom:28px}.review_description:before{font-size:80px;left:-4px;top:-20px}.review_description div,.review_description p,.review_description span{font-size:17px;line-height:1.7}.review_image img{width:62px}.cust-customer-story-group-single>div:last-child div,.cust-customer-story-group-single>div:last-child p,.cust-customer-story-group-single>div:last-child span{font-size:16px;line-height:1.7}}